The garage occupancy feed for the Brindlewood campus arrives over a message queue every thirty seconds, one record per level, published by the Stallgrid edge boxes. Counts can briefly go negative when a sensor double-fires on exit; the ingest job clamps these to zero and flags the interval. If the feed stalls for more than five minutes, the dashboard falls back to the last known snapshot. Sensor mappings, queue names, and the replay procedure are documented on the internal page below.

runbook for tahog-kadug: https://gitlab.qirvanworks.corp/projects/pages/view/b139298aed28

Subject: Handover — Ladleworks scaling DB

Hi Priya,

Before I roll off, here's what you need for the Ladleworks recipe-scaling calculator. The ingredient ratio tables live in a single primary with nightly snapshots; the conversion-factor view must be refreshed after any unit table change. All maintenance jobs authenticate as the steward role. The primary is reachable at the connection string below.

replica DSN, fahif-bagag: cockroachdb://casok_svc:V7@db-3280.zemvarsoft.example:5432/briion

Hi all — quick one from the front desk. The Tidemark cleaning crew now comes in at 18:30 instead of 19:00, so don't be surprised when they show up early. Sign them in as usual, check their lanyards, and point new faces to the service lift. They'll need the door pass for the loading corridor, which is below.

turnstile pass: bdg-NG-3

**Finance Review Summary — Corvane Foods**

Sales leads, heads up: we've switched from Pellar Freight to Nordwick Logistics as of this quarter. Short version — Pellar's rates jumped 12%, Nordwick came in under our old baseline with better cold-chain coverage for the Tillby region. Expect a two-week transition wobble on delivery windows, so manage customer expectations accordingly. Finance sees roughly 4% savings on distribution overall. Further plans are noted below.

internal memo for kawip-hadug: Headcount on the Wenwyn team goes from 7 to 140 by the end of January. Gross margin on Wenwyn came in at 20 percent against a plan of 15 percent.